Why Movement? Your Body Won't Let You Fall

About this episode

Put aside your self-help books. Step away for a moment from the your therapy session. Consider movement as a key ingredient you've been missing.

In a world that's so focused on thinking and feeling, why would movement be necessary for self-improvement? Let's find out.

Moshe Feldenkrais in his book Awareness Through Movement gives 9 reasons for Why Movement? We tackle the first one: Your nervous system is preoccupied mainly with movement.

Expect to learn:
- why nervous system is primarily concerned with movement
- you're the descendent of a great line of movers
- put your feet up like Freud

This is episode one in a nine episode series.
